D.C. Mun. Regs. tit. 8-B, § 1443
1443.1 Each college shall have the responsibility of forming its own committee on promotions.
1443.2 The committee shall have a minimum of five (5) and a maximum of ten (10) voting members. Efforts shall be made to have the committee composed of a ratio of 2:2:1 (professors: associate professors: assistant professor).
1443.3 The committee shall include regular (full-time) faculty members, each of whom shall have a minimum of three (3) years of service to the University and shall have been elected by appropriate units within the college in the preceding academic year.
1443.4 The dean of the college shall serve as an ex-officio, non-voting member of the committee. The full committee shall elect its own chairperson.
1443.5 No committee member shall be eligible to apply for promotion during the year of service on the committee.
1443.6 The proceedings of the committee shall remain confidential.
